8.2 Decoder output formatter
The output interface block of the decoder part contains the ITU 656 formatter for the
expansion port data output XPD7 to XPD0 (for a detailed description see
and the control circuit for the signals needed for the internal paths to the scaler and data
slicer part. It also controls the selection of the reference signals for the RT port (RTCO,
RTS0 and RTS1) and the expansion port (XRH, XRV and XDQ).
The generation of the decoder data type control signals SET_RAW and SET VBI is also
done within this block. These signals are decoded from the requested data type for the
scaler input and/or the data slicer, selectable by the control registers LCR2 to LCR24 (see
also
For each LCR value from 2 to 23 the data type can be programmed individually;
LCR2 to LCR23 refer to line numbers. The selection in LCR24 values is valid for the rest
of the corresponding field. The upper nibble contains the value for field 1 (odd), the lower
nibble for field 2 (even). The relationship between LCR values and line numbers can be
adjusted via VOFF8 to VOFF0, located in subaddresses 5Bh (bit D4) and 5Ah
(bits D7 to D0) and FOFF subaddress 5Bh (bit D7). The recommended values are
VOFF[8:0] = 03h for 50 Hz sources (with FOFF = 0) and VOFF[8:0] = 06h for 60 Hz
sources (with FOFF = 1), to accommodate line number conventions as used for PAL,
SECAM and NTSC standards; see
